About South Duffield

South Duffield is a small village located in North Yorkshire, England, within the Yorkshire and the Humber region. Situated a few miles east of the market town of Selby and west of Goole, it lies in the flat, agricultural landscape of the Vale of York. The village is characterized by its rural setting, typical of many settlements in this part of the county, and is located relatively close to the River Ouse. Its local context is primarily agricultural, reflecting the surrounding countryside.
